Understanding Accessory Dwelling Units (ADUs) in Santa Monica

Accessory Dwelling Units (ADUs), often called granny flats, in-law suites, or backyard cottages, are self-contained living spaces located on the same property as a primary residence. ADUs have gained popularity across Santa Monica and Southern California due to their ability to provide additional housing, generate rental income, and increase home value.

Benefits of Building an ADU in Santa Monica

  • Increased Property Value – An ADU can raise your home’s market worth, making it a smart long-term investment.
  • Rental Income – ADUs offer a lucrative opportunity to generate passive income by renting out the unit.
  • Multigenerational Living – Homeowners can provide a comfortable space for aging parents or adult children while maintaining privacy.
  • Sustainable Housing Solution – With California’s push for more housing, ADUs are an eco-friendly way to increase housing density without major urban sprawl.

Types of ADUs You Can Build in Santa Monica

  • Detached ADUs – A standalone structure, typically in the backyard.
  • Attached ADUs – An expansion of the main home, sharing at least one wall.
  • Garage Conversions – Transforming an existing garage into a fully functional living space.
  • Basement or Internal ADUs – Converting part of an existing home into a separate unit.

A Deep Dive into Santa Monica’s Zoning Laws

While California law encourages ADU development, Santa Monica maintains specific zoning regulations that determine where and how ADUs can be built.

Key Zoning Regulations for ADUs in Santa Monica

  • Lot Size Requirements – While Santa Monica allows ADUs on most residential lots, specific size restrictions apply.
  • Setback Rules – ADUs generally need a 4-foot setback from side and rear property lines.
  • Height Limits – Detached ADUs are often limited to 16 feet in height, but exceptions exist for two-story units.
  • Parking Requirements – Santa Monica typically waives additional parking requirements if the ADU is near public transit.
  • Owner-Occupancy Rules – As of recent state laws, owner-occupancy requirements for ADUs have been lifted until at least 2025.

The Role of California State Laws in Shaping ADU Regulations

Santa Monica’s zoning laws must align with California state laws, which have evolved to promote ADU development.

Key California ADU Laws That Affect Santa Monica

  • Senate Bill 9 (SB 9) – Allows homeowners to split lots and add multiple units, making ADU development more accessible.
  • AB 68 & AB 881 – Reduce ADU approval times and eliminate minimum lot size requirements.
  • SB 13 – Prevents excessive local fees and eliminates owner-occupancy requirements until at least 2025.

State vs. Local ADU Regulations

While California laws override restrictive local zoning codes, cities like Santa Monica still set regulations on setbacks, height limits, and architectural design requirements.

Did You Know? Homeowners in Santa Monica can now build both an ADU and a Junior ADU (JADU) on the same lot, allowing for increased rental potential and multi-generational housing solutions.

Navigating the Permit Process for Building an ADU in Santa Monica

Building an ADU requires approval from the City of Santa Monica, and obtaining permits is a crucial step in the process.

Steps to Getting Your ADU Permit Approved

  1. Check Zoning Laws – Ensure your property qualifies for ADU construction.
  2. Develop ADU Plans – Work with an experienced builder to design your ADU while meeting zoning requirements.
  3. Submit Permit Application – File your ADU permit application with Santa Monica’s Planning and Development Department.
  4. Provide Required Documentation – Typically includes architectural plans, site surveys, and environmental impact reports.
  5. Await Approval – Approval times vary but typically range from 60-120 days.
